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
15276 86219914 22864870287
67391 139 8273852892
67391 139 8273852892
91355245 28918922455 676 77941 4597245
All about undefined
Interested in learning more?
67391 139 8273852892
91355245 28918922455 676 77941 4597245
See more
80443002 90517779 482942963
4404 115510031 04
See more
12 702105115
9439 932685 58 697 40417
See more